Output 6793e5526b820dff84ef5f7d0e16afae5867e9181c9a2331b46d0a084bf222aa:11

value
1640000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84bbc37ff66b113a93e337becf95ee52aa326812 OP_EQUAL
address
3Dnr3uxpzwD5zgEhUfJVzY8FDLw9hyFSVP
transaction
6793e5526b820dff84ef5f7d0e16afae5867e9181c9a2331b46d0a084bf222aa
spent
true